Chiller running mode is determined by FCU
status base on threshold value
Set to FCU ,
If one FCU is ON, Chiller turn ON automatically
If all FCUs are OFF, Chiller turn OFF
automatically
Priority Setting
Manual ON the Chiller will be turn OFF
automatically by the setting if all the FCU is
OFF

Holiday Setting
All the FCU and Chiller will be turn OFF
Temporally Disable all the timer schedules
10 sets of Holiday Schedules
99 days duration for each holiday
FCU can be opened manually ; FCU will switch off at 00:00am for the following day if it still in holiday mode
